About this House

This single-family home is located at 150 Wake Ct, Vallejo, CA. 150 Wake Ct is in the Richardson Park neighborhood in Vallejo, CA and in ZIP code 94589. This property has 4 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ms and approximately 1,894 sqft of floor space. This property has a lot size of 6098 sqft and was built in 1984.
150 Wake Ct, Vallejo, CA 94589 is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,894 sqft single-family home in Richardson Park, built in 1984.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$564,300, with a rent estimate of $3,027/month.
